Abstract
The published structure of has unusually short (1.94 Å) Ni-O bond lengths. We reexamined the structure of using monochromatic synchrotron x-ray radiation. Rietveld refinement of the structure in space group Bbcm yielded Fourier synthesis () maps that suggest a modified structural model for . The refined structure contains chemically more reasonable interatomic distances (e.g., shortest Ni-O distance of 2.00 Å). A comparison of this structure with that of the superconductor reveals disparities in the conduction planes of the two materials that may explain differences in electrical behavior.
